Air Bags: Dual-stage frontal, driver and right-front passenger: (click here for important details)

Dual-stage air bags are engineered to help protect the driver and right-front passenger by supplementing the safety belts.

Always use safety belts and the correct child restraints for your child's age and size, even in vehicles equipped with air bags. Children are safer when properly secured in a rear seat. See the vehicle's Owner's Manual and child safety seat instructions for safety information.

Brakes: Four-wheel antilock, 4-wheel disc.

The antilock brake system (ABS) is designed to help drivers maintain steering control by reducing wheel lockup during hard braking on most slippery or dry surfaces.

Theft-Deterrent system: Vehicle -- PASS-Key III

As an added security feature, the Chevy Uplander features the PASS-Key III theft-deterrent system, which includes a special ignition key with up to three trillion possible code variations. If an attempt is made to start your vehicle without the properly coded key, the starter and fuel injectors are temporarily disabled.

Traction Control: All-speed

Traction Control reduces engine power to help reduce wheel slip during acceleration on many surfaces.
